Hi all,

After taking my Razr Maxx for a swim in the ocean, I managed to get it working again after taking it apart and replacing the battery. However, aside from a few other problems, it now refuses to update. It is currently on version 2.3.6 and I'd like to update it at least to ICS, if not to JB. It downloads the update but only gets about a third of the way into the installation before rebooting itself. Now, I would try rooting it and manually installing the update, but the up volume button no longer works. Is there a way to root it without the use of that button, or any other way to apply the update?

Thanks in advance!

If you disabled any stock apps or uninstalled any stock apps the update will fail. If you uninstalled any apps you will have to download DROID razr utility for gingerbread I believe it's version 1.6 and take your phone back to stock. Just Google it and you should be able to find it. There are plenty of threads on this site too.

I don't think any of this will work though. You have to put your phone into ap fastboot mode, and to do this you need your volume up button. Hopefully you just disabled some apps and it will work out. Or maybe someone else on here knows a different way.

He can still boot into fastboot by enabling USB debugging and in the cmd prompt input "adb reboot bootloader"
